The steel substrate of a vessel can grow for many causes, freezing of the interior contents and about-pressurization from the vessel getting the two most commonly encountered. This expansion results in a series of cracks for the lining.

It is good follow to take care of a logbook for every vessel, indicating the day of set up and also the dates and benefits of spark tests, visual inspections and glass-thickness tests. The log can help maintenance glass lined reactor specification personnel to find out the approximated service life of the tools and could support prevent a vessel failure.

The suitable interval between glass-thickness measurements depends upon a number of variables. In the event the reactants used inside a process are certainly aggressive, it could be a good idea to evaluate the thickness with the reactor’s glass lining each and every a few to six months.
